The Datadog Agent is software that runs on customer infrastructure and supports a wide range of platforms. It efficiently collects observability data from millions of hosts and sends them to Datadog, where our customers can analyze their monitoring and performance data. OpenTelemetry (OTel) is an open source, vendor-neutral observability solution that allows teams to monitor their applications and services in a standardized format.

We are looking for an experienced Software Engineer who will help us ensure that OpenTelemetry users deploying the open-source Datadog Agent can get access to all of Datadog's industry-leading observability solutions and can continue to leverage OpenTelemetry-specific capabilities (via the embedded OTel Collector). What You’ll Do: 

  • Develop high-performance OTel observability pipelines in the Datadog Agent, running on customers’ infrastructures and targeting a large number of platforms / environments / deployment models, with Datadog-specific and upstream OpenTelemetry contributions
  • Simplify customers’ onboarding and management of OTel pipelines with Fleet Management capabilities
  • Review community contributions to Datadog-related components of OTel
  • Take part in investigating and fixing issues with the internal production deployment of the Datadog Agent
  • With your team, be a driving force in product decisions and plan the most important projects to work on next

What you need to know about the San Francisco Tech Scene

San Francisco and the surrounding Bay Area attracts more startup funding than any other region in the world. Home to Stanford University and UC Berkeley, leading VC firms and several of the world’s most valuable companies, the Bay Area is the place to go for anyone looking to make it big in the tech industry. That said, San Francisco has a lot to offer beyond technology thanks to a thriving art and music scene, excellent food and a short drive to several of the country’s most beautiful recreational areas.

Key Facts About San Francisco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 365,500; 13.9%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Google, Apple, Salesforce, Meta
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, cloud computing, fintech, consumer technology, software
  • Funding Landscape: $50.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Sequoia Capital, Andreessen Horowitz, Bessemer Venture Partners, Greylock Partners, Khosla Ventures, Kleiner Perkins
  • Research Centers and Universities: Stanford University; University of California, Berkeley; University of San Francisco; Santa Clara University; Ames Research Center; Center for AI Safety; California Institute for Regenerative Medicine
